Summer in Malta is more than just sunshine and beach days, it’s a season filled with vibrant village festas, crystal-clear waters, delicious local food, and unforgettable Mediterranean sunsets. As the season begins to wind down, now is the perfect time to make the most of everything the Maltese Islands have to offer. Whether you’re a local or a visitor, here are 30 things to do before summer ends.
1. Spend a Day at Għadira Bay
Malta’s largest sandy beach is perfect for swimming, relaxing, and enjoying the warm Mediterranean Sea.
2. Explore the Blue Lagoon
Take a boat trip to Comino and swim in the famous turquoise waters before the summer crowds disappear.
3. Attend a Village Festa
Summer is festa season in Malta. Experience fireworks, band marches, street decorations, and local traditions.
4. Watch the Sunset at Dingli Cliffs
One of the most breathtaking locations on the islands, Dingli Cliffs offers spectacular sunset views.
5. Visit Mdina at Night
The Silent City takes on a magical atmosphere during warm summer evenings.
6. Enjoy a Traditional Maltese Ftira
Treat yourself to one of Malta’s most beloved local foods, filled with fresh Mediterranean ingredients.
7. Take a Harbour Cruise
See Valletta’s impressive fortifications and the historic Three Cities from the sea.
8. Swim at Golden Bay
Enjoy golden sands and crystal-clear waters while soaking up the final weeks of summer.
9. Explore Gozo
Spend a day discovering charming villages, coastal views, and hidden swimming spots.
10. Visit Popeye Village
A colourful attraction that offers great photo opportunities and family-friendly fun.
11. Snorkel in Crystal-Clear Waters
Discover marine life around Cirkewwa, Għar Lapsi, or Comino.
12. Walk Along the Sliema Promenade
Enjoy sea views, cafés, and one of Malta’s most popular waterfront walks.
13. Visit St Peter’s Pool
This natural swimming spot is ideal for cliff jumping and cooling off.
